It’s officially spring at Disneyland, which means one of our favorite treats EVER is now available at Candy Palace. We’ll give you some hints… ready? Okay, it’s super sweet and chocolatey, handmade, and the PERFECT Easter basket filler. Have you guessed it yet?
It’s the Handmade Chocolate Fudge Easter Egg! Every Monday, Wednesday, and Saturday until Easter, you can get your fix of fudge-y goodness at Candy Palace, where the eggs are sold for $12.99 each.
We still don’t have word about what flavor options will be available this year, but y’all already know our opinion on these Easter Egg flavors from last year…
Nothing will EVER compete with the Peanut Butter Fudge!
One of the best parts of these eggs is the SIZE of them! While they’re definitely big enough to share (especially because they’re so rich), we recommend saving it all for yourself. You’ve gotta keep your energy high for your next Disneyland ride, right?! Hopefully, your sugar crash won’t hit you until you arrive at Great Moments With Mr. Lincoln.
They also come with adorable garnishes, like flowers and adorable baby chicks made out of (you guessed it) more sugar! The boxes are usually pretty cute as well, and in the past have featured bunnies, colorful eggs, and more.
Oh, and we forgot to mention another awesome detail: You actually can watch the Cast Members MAKE the eggs at Candy Palace! Nothing will work up your appetite like watching this process.
